One way of looking at this problem, that fits well with an expansion I am trying to figure out, is that when I know Robin's position on the question, I should update my probability distribution for Eliezer's position, which should affect the likelihood ratios for Eliezer's observed position with respect to the positions of the person whose opinion is being predicted.
